(Background: NCTA today filed this Motion to Intervene in the U.S. Court of Appeals for the D.C. Circuit)
“We have filed to intervene in support of Comcast’s appeal of the FCC network management order. We do so because of the significant and potentially harmful implications of this decision for the vast majority of consumers who are served by network providers. While we support the FCC’s Internet Policy Statement, we do not believe the FCC has the authority to make up rules on the fly.”

NCTA is the principal trade association for the U.S. cable industry, representing cable operators serving more than 90 percent of the nation's cable television households and more than 200 cable program networks. The cable industry is the nation’s largest broadband provider of high-speed Internet access after investing more than $130 billion to build a two-way interactive network with fiber optic technology. Cable companies also provide state-of-the-art digital telephone service to millions of American consumers.
